Carbon Fiber
Carbon Fiber is extremely tough and lightweight. This makes it an ideal material for a frame for a power wheelchair particularly when it is molded to the shape of the user. It also has the ability to flex to absorb the impact of uneven terrain and provide a smooth ride. Carbon chairs are the lightest powerchair on the market, with a weight just 32 pounds.
This advanced material is created by forming thin filaments of carbon atoms joined in a crystalline structure. These fibers are weaved into sheets or sandwich laminates and then infused with resins to produce an extremely stiff material that is strong and light. The material can be used to create high-performance components for aerospace, automotive and sporting goods applications.
The process of making carbon fiber is a complex process and requires a substantial investment in equipment and knowledge. The process starts with a pre-cursor of polymers, which is the molecular foundation for carbon-rich fibers. Historically, the carbon fibers were derived from pitch or rayon. Today they are primarily made of polyacrylonitrile, which is derived from the chemical ammonia, a common commodity, and propylene.
Once carbon fiber is manufactured, it can be shaped and layered to form composite materials to create various products. The strength and stiffness of the material can be controlled by changing the temperature at which it is treated. Carbon fibers can be heated to increase their tensile strength or modulus of elastic.
